Im running them on my truck..everything is a really good fit. Only thing I didnt like is the paint burns off with in the first 5mins of running the truck, but cant really complain cause they are inexpensive and fit great.
thats not paint, it\'s just a coating to keep them from rusting while in the box.

I have a 73 engine the newer manifolds dont hit all the bolt holes and I dont want an adapter(another place to leak)Everything was fine except passenger side was close to firewall and would need a sharp bend to clear.Headers will allow more room on drivers side so engine can be centered.Now a new problem the wife says no more parts baked in her oven(DUPLICOLOR CERAMIC) Guess Igotta wait till she leaves for work
